  3. Apr 30, 2026Self-reported incident
    1 finding · critical
    • CriticalTexas: High

      Responsibilities of Employees and Caregivers -Demonstrate Competency, Good Judgment, Self-control

      It was determined a caregiver improperly picked up a child by the wrist resulting in an injury to the child's elbow.

      Corrected May 21, 2026, verified May 27, 2026.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.1201(1).

  9. Oct 19, 2022Inspection
    4 findings · serious
    • SeriousTexas: Medium High

      Food Allergy Emergency Plan Signed by Parents and Health Care Professional

      Upon reivew of files it was observed that a child with a diagnosed allergy had an allergy plan that was lacking the parent signature. Furthermore, the epi-pen brought for the child was not in the original container and was not labeled with the date it was brought to the center. There was also no allergy notice posted for the child in any of the rooms the child spends time in.

      Corrected Oct 28, 2022, verified Nov 1, 2022.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.3819.

    • SeriousTexas: Medium High

      Child/ Caregiver Ratio - 13 or More Children

      A caregiver was observed supervising a group of 14 children where the specified age group was 2 yrs old. The ages of children were as follows: 1- 22 mo old 6- 2 yr olds 7- 3 yr olds Please note this was observed as children were laying down to nap. None of the children in the room were asleep.

      Corrected Oct 19, 2022, verified Nov 1, 2022.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.1601.

    • SeriousTexas: Medium

      Documentation of Drills

      The fire drill for September 2022 was not documented.

      Corrected Oct 21, 2022, verified Oct 19, 2022. Standard 746.5205(4).

    • SeriousTexas: Medium High

      Maintenance of Building, Grounds and Equipment

      A portion of the chainlink fence on the play ground was observed to have come unattached from the frame causing a possible entrapment hazard for children in care.

      Corrected Oct 28, 2022, verified Oct 19, 2022. Technical assistance given. Standard 746.3407.
